Вопросы-ответы - все решения ➜ страница 131


Задать вопрос

Как разделить несколько команд, переданных eval в bash

Я пытаюсь вычислить несколько строк команд оболочки с помощью eval, но когда я пытаюсь разрешить переменные с eval, разделенными новой строкой n, переменные не разрешаются. x='echo a' y='echo b' z="$xn$y" eval $x eval $y eval $z Который выводит: a b anecho b Последняя команда дает anecho b, и, по-видимому, n трактовалось там как n. Итак, есть ли способ оценить несколько строк команд (скажем, разделенных n)? ...

C# передача данных между классами

Просто интересно, как люди будут идти по этому поводу. Допустим, у меня есть один класс, который создает и заполняет Treeview, который затем добавляется в Winform. У меня есть еще один класс, который зависит от данных в Treeview. Так, например, когда пользователь щелкает на определенном узле в Treeview, классу b требуется та информация, которую узел содержит, чтобы он мог выполнить некоторые вычисления и отобразить результат. Не лучше ли просто передать ссылку на Treeview ко второму классу и ...

Невозможно извлечь значения из словаря, заданного в VBA / Access 2003

Я пишу сценарий, который извлекает некоторые данные пациента и генерирует экспорт XML. У каждого пациента есть связанный врач - но вместо того, чтобы повторять детали врача в каждой записи, я решил установить идентификатор врача в истории болезни пациента, а затем включить список врачей в другой раздел в нижней части документа. Одна вещь, которую мне нужно сделать, - это включить GUID для врача в историю болезни пациента, но фактическое отношение базы данных является локальным не уникальным ИД ...

Выход из цикла с помощью внешнего метода

Я программирую с помощью Arduino, и моя программа содержит много циклов while. Когда Arduino получает символ, он должен выполнить некоторые вычисления и вырваться из цикла, в котором он находился, когда он получил символ. Я приведу вам более простой пример (предположим, что i и j равны 0): while (i < 256) { // some calculations #1 i++; if (Serial.available() > 0) { setStringOne = "string one" setStringTwo = "string two" setStringThree = "string th ...

Массив / связанный список: производительность зависит от * направления * обхода? [закрытый]

Этот пост разделен на два основных раздела. В первом разделе представлены оригинальные тестовые случаи и результаты, а также мои мысли об этом. Во втором разделе подробно описывается модифицированный тестовый случай и его результаты. Первоначальное название этой темы было "полная итерация по массиву значительно быстрее, чем со связанным списком". Название было изменено в связи с новыми результатами тестирования (представленными во втором разделе). Раздел первый: первоначальный тест Дело Дл ...

Git: как скомбинировать все коммиты между двумя коммитами в один коммит

У меня есть филиал, над которым я лично работал на нескольких компьютерах в течение последних нескольких месяцев. В результате получается длинная цепочка истории, которую я хочу очистить, прежде чем объединять ее в главную ветвь. В конечном счете цель состоит в том, чтобы избавиться от всех тех НЗП коммитов, которые я часто делаю при работе над кодом сервера. Вот скриншот визуализации истории gitk: http://imgur.com/a/I9feO Путь в нижней части этого точка, где я отделился от мастера. Масте ...

Как удалить несколько изображений docker с одним imageID?

Я создал локальный реестр docker, а затем извлек некоторые из моих образов docker из Docker hub и затем переместил их в локальный реестр. Теперь я хочу удалить свои локальные изображения. Но проблема здесь заключается в том, что imageID изображений одинаковы, и я не могу удалить их. Я искал решение, но я не мог найти решение. >> docker images REPOSITORY TAG IMAGE ID CREATED VIRTUAL SIZE localhost:5000/[repo1] v-0.9.1 ...

Как сделать бесконечную прокрутку img слайдера?

Я почти закончил веб-сайт для клиента на работе, который имеет большой динамический слайдер полной ширины на главной странице. Поскольку они дали мало спецификаций, в настоящее время слайдер очень прост; он просто прокручивается слева направо, изменяя свойство Left CSS на UL. Очевидно, из-за этого он будет прокручиваться внезапно назад к началу, как только он достигнет конца, чего клиенты, по-видимому, не хотят. Я не эксперт по jQuery, и мне было интересно, как я могу легко измените этот ползун ...

Как работает enum.toString() работает под капотом?

Я разработчик iOS и сожалею, что в Objective-C нет удивительного метода toString для перечисления, как в C# Поэтому мне очень любопытно узнать, как метод toString работает для перечисления в C#. Может быть, с вашими ответами я пойму, почему Objective-C не реализовал этот метод. Спасибо ...

Как присвоить целочисленное значение переменной на основе элемента, выбранного на Android Spinner.?

Я установил адаптер массива для моего спиннера, чтобы отобразить выпадающий список оценок (A+, A, ...прием). Все, что мне нужно, это когда пользователь выбирает, A+, myApp должен понимать его как плавающее значение 10, так что значение A+ (=10)может быть использовано в формуле, которая нуждается в integer для вычисления общей оценки. например, если пользователь выбирает B+, мое приложение должно понимать как 8.5, которое может быть использовано в Формуле. В основном, я хочу, чтобы пользовател ...

Обновить столбец таблицы с помощью столбца другой таблицы в PostgreSQL

Я хочу скопировать все значения из одного столбца val1 таблицы table1 в один столбец val2 другой таблицы table2. Я попробовал эту команду в PostgreSQL: update table2 set val2 = (select val1 from table1) Но я получил эту ошибку: Ошибка: более одной строки, возвращаемой подзапросом, используемым в качестве выражения Есть ли альтернатива для этого? ...

создание базы данных из postgreSQL с помощью symfony

Я работаю с mapbender3, который разработан в symfony2 на моей локальной машине. Меня просят подключить приложение к удаленному серверу potgreSQL. Ниже приведена конфигурация в параметрах .файл yml . parameters: database_driver: pdo_pgsql database_host: 192.168.3.100 database_port: 5434 database_name: idc_core database_path: ~ database_user: ******* database_password: ******* mailer_transport: smtp mailer_host: localhost mail ...

Python print не использует repr, unicode или str для подкласса unicode?

Python print не использует __repr__, __unicode__ или __str__ для моего подкласса unicode при печати. Есть какие-нибудь намеки на то, что я делаю не так? Вот мой код: Использование Python 2.5.2 (r252:60911, Oct 13 2009, 14:11:59) >>> class MyUni(unicode): ... def __repr__(self): ... return "__repr__" ... def __unicode__(self): ... return unicode("__unicode__") ... def __str__(self): ... return str("__str__") ... >>> s = MyUni("HI") ...

Модуль Ansible blockinfile idempotent?

Я хочу вставить несколько строк в файл, используя модуль blockinfile. Задача выглядит примерно так: name: add some lines become: true blockinfile: dest: /etc/sysctl.conf block: | mykey1={{ kernvars['my_value1'] }} mykey2={{ kernvars['my_value2'] }} mykey3={{ kernvars['my_value3'] }} Есть ли способ для модуля (или соответствующего шаблона) проверить и вставить определенные строки, только если они еще не существуют? Используя ansible 2.0.0.2 на Ubun ...

boost proto vs C# дерево выражений

Во-первых, мне интересно, имеют ли обе "функции" одну и ту же цель. Во-вторых, если да (или только частично да), есть ли какое-либо существенное ограничение в boost proto over дерево выражений c# Спасибо ...

Порядок загрузки contextConfigLocation в web.xml проекта Spring Servlet

Предположим, что у меня есть проектSpring Java , и я пытаюсь настроить его как сервлет веб-сервера. Вот урезанная версия web.xml файл: <context-param> <param-name>contextConfigLocation</param-name> <param-value> /WEB-INF/spring/generalApplicationContext.xml </param-value> </context-param> <servlet> <servlet-name>my-servlet</servlet-name> <servlet-class>org.springframework.web.servlet.DispatcherServlet< ...

Как использовать XMLHttpRequest в GWT?

XMLHttpRequest является альтернативой HTTP-вызовам со стороны клиента GWT и позволяет контролировать все аспекты запросов/ответов. Но как им пользоваться? адрес javadoc: http://www.gwtproject.org/javadoc/latest/com/google/gwt/xhr/client/class-use/XMLHttpRequest.html ...

C# эквивалент Scala Promise

В scala есть Promises и Futures. С помощью Promise я могу контролировать, когда Future завершается, т. е. val p = Promise[Int]() val fut: Future[Int] = p.future // I already have a running Future here // here I can do whatever I want and when I decide Future should complete, I can simply say p success 7 // and fut is now completed with value 7 Как я могу достичь аналогичных результатов с помощью API C# Task? Я не смог найти ничего подобного в документах. Я хочу использовать это в тесте, из ...

Пустой Ярлык ChoiceField Django

Как заставить метку ChoiceField вести себя как ModelChoiceField? Есть ли способ установить empty_label или, по крайней мере, показать пустое поле? Forms.py: thing = forms.ModelChoiceField(queryset=Thing.objects.all(), empty_label='Label') color = forms.ChoiceField(choices=COLORS) year = forms.ChoiceField(choices=YEAR_CHOICES) Я попробовал решения, предложенные здесь: Переполнение стека Q - установка CHOICES = [('','All')] + CHOICES привела к внутренней ошибке сервера. Переп ...

Как подключиться к базе данных SQL Server Ce с языка C#?

Как подключить SQL Server CE Db к C# DotNet 4.0 Я слышал о системе.Данные.Пространство имен SqlServerCe для подключения локальной базы данных, но я не могу найти его в .Net 4.0 Есть ли альтернативный класс? ...

Я не могу компилировать в Visual Studio 2010

У меня всегда так много проблем с компиляцией программ в Visual Studio 2010. Я прошу прощения за свою зеленость. Я получаю ошибки LNK и не уверен, что это вызывает их. Я надеюсь, что кто-нибудь сможет заметить что-то из журнала сборки. Наверное, что-нибудь глупое ... Build started 4/8/2012 3:22:37 PM. 1>Project "c:UsersDonalddocumentsvisual studio 2010ProjectsClientServermyClientmyClient.vcxproj" on node 2 (build target(s)). 1>InitializeBuildStatus: Touching "DebugmyClient ...

Преобразование метки времени в другой часовой пояс в BigQuery

Я несколько раз просматривал документацию Google , но я не могу найти простую функцию (в пределах запроса SELECT) для преобразования метки времени UTC в другой часовой пояс, который в моем случае является Тихоокеанским. Для большинства международных часовых поясов я могу просто использовать TIMESTAMP_SUB или TIMESTAMP_ADD для вычитания / добавления смещенных часов, но использование Соединенными Штатами летнего времени усложняет ситуацию (без необходимости!). Я что-то пропустил в документации? ...

Почему uint32 t предпочтительнее, чем uint fast32 t?

Кажется, что uint32_t гораздо более распространено, чем uint_fast32_t (я понимаю, что это анекдотическое свидетельство). Хотя мне это кажется противоречащим здравому смыслу. Почти всегда, когда я вижу, что реализация использует uint32_t, все, что ей действительно нужно, - это целое число, которое может содержать значения до 4,294,967,295 (обычно гораздо более низкая граница где-то между 65,535 и 4,294,967,295). Кажется странным использовать uint32_t, так как 'ровно 32 бита' гарантия не нужна, ...

Добавление CSRFToken в Ajax запрос

Мне нужно передать CSRFToken с Ajax-запросом на основе post, но не уверен, как это можно сделать наилучшим образом. Использование платформы, которая внутренне проверяет CSRFToken в запросе (только POST request) Изначально я думал добавить его в заголовок, как $(function() { $.ajaxSetup({ headers : { 'CSRFToken' : getCSRFTokenValue() } }); }); , который сделает его доступным для каждого запроса Ajax, но он не будет работать в моем случае, так как в запрос ...

Сохранение и загрузка грузов в керасе

Я пытаюсь сохранить и загрузить веса из модели, которую я обучил. Код, который я использую для сохранения модели, есть. TensorBoard(log_dir='/output') model.fit_generator(image_a_b_gen(batch_size), steps_per_epoch=1, epochs=1) model.save_weights('model.hdf5') model.save_weights('myModel.h5') Дайте мне знать, если это неправильный способ сделать это, или если есть лучший способ сделать это. Но когда я пытаюсь загрузить их, используя это, from keras.models import load_model model = load_mod ...

Как git-merge работает с двоичными файлами

Рассмотрим такую ситуацию: o---o---o slave / o---o---B---o---o master У меня есть куча двоичных файлов. Некоторые из них не изменились ни в slave, ни в master, некоторые другие изменились на slave. Во время слияния: git checkout master git merge slave ГИТ показал мне вот что: warning: Cannot merge binary files: foo.bin (HEAD vs. foo) Auto-merging: foo.bin CONFLICT (content): Merge conflict in foo.bin Automatic merge failed; fix conflicts and then commit t ...

Preon на Android

Я попытался запустить пример приложения Preon на Android 2.1 без успеха. Интересно, возможно ли вообще запустить приложение Preon на Android. Насколько трудно будет сделать Преон-фреймворк Далвик дружественным? Preon-это библиотека Java для построения кодеков для данных, сжатых в битовом потоке, декларативным способом. Подумайте о JAXB или Hibernate, но тогда для двоичных кодированных данных, написанных Уилфредом Спрингером. Ниже приведены мои находки при попытке запустить простое приложение, ...

Получение данных с помощью инструкции select SQL в Powershell

Моя цель-присвоить значение возвращаемых результатов переменной: $SqlConnection = New-Object System.Data.SqlClient.SqlConnection $SqlConnection.ConnectionString = "Server=HOMESQLEXPRESS;Database=master;Integrated Security=True" $SqlCmd = New-Object System.Data.SqlClient.SqlCommand $SqlCmd.CommandText = "select name from sysdatabases where name = 'tempdb'" $SqlCmd.Connection = $SqlConnection $SqlAdapter = New-Object System.Data.SqlClient.SqlDataAdapter $SqlAdapter.SelectCommand = $SqlCmd $Data ...

Создание списков и наборов в Scala: что я на самом деле получаю?

Если я создам Set в Scala, используя Set(1, 2, 3), я получу immutable.Set. scala> val s = Set(1, 2, 3) s: scala.collection.immutable.Set[Int] = Set(1, 2, 3) Q1: что это за набор на самом деле? Это какой-то хэш-набор? Какова, например, сложность поиска? Q2: где я могу прочитать об этом методе "создания наборов"? Я думал, что это метод apply, но в документах сказано: " Этот метод позволяет интерпретировать наборы как предикаты. Возвращает true, если этот набор содержит элемент Элем. " ...

MapStruct требует класс Impl

У меня есть следующие классы: Картограф public interface DeviceTokensMapper { DeviceTokensMapper INSTANCE = Mappers.getMapper(DeviceTokensMapper.class); @Mappings({ @Mapping(source = "tokenName", target = "tokenName"), @Mapping(source = "userOsType", target = "osType"), }) DeviceTokensDTO toDeviceTokensDTO(DeviceTokens deviceTokens); } Сущность: @Entity public class DeviceTokens { @Id @Column(name="token_name", nullable = false) p ...